The manufacturing technician (VOLT Expansion) position supports the development and implementation of optimal, cost-effective manufacturing processes and methods in accordance with product specifications and quality standards; recommends and implements improvements to production processes, methods and controls; supports the activities related to instalation and validation of production lines as well as the lifecycle managment of equipments.
What You’ll Do
- Daily support to the manufacturing activities in order to to meet established goals for safety, quality, cost and production.
- Maintains systems that support the monitoring of key performance indicators such as yield, per operators, reject parettos, etc. If indicators show an adverse trend, works with the functional team to plan and implement appropiate changes.
- Lead yield/productivity analysis & improvement plans. Analyzes defective material to identify probable cause.
- Executes installation/validation activities for new or existent production lines, meeting regulatory requirements.
- Supports on the identification, selection and purchasing equipment/fixtures according to production requirements.
- Keeps equipment operational by coordinating calibration, maintenance and repair services; following manufacturer's instructions and established procedures; requesting special service when needed.
- Able to interpret product requirements and specifications. Understands potential risks related to product malfunctions.
- Has clear criteria of conforming/ non conforming product and the test methods used for verifying conformance.
- Drives/executes change requets process within the area as required. Supports DL's training process.
- Work in a cross functional team environment.
- Paticipates in the identification and investigation of Non-conforming products. Uses Root cause problem solving techniques to identify and eliminate causes.
